Misalignment is among the most typical problems faced by UPVC doors. In time, the door may end up being misaligned due to modifications in temperature, humidity, or settling of the home's structure.
Repair Steps:
Inspect the Door: Check if the door is rubbing versus the frame or the flooring.Adjust the Hinges: Use a screwdriver to tighten or loosen up the hinge screws.Usage Shims: If alignment is still off, consider using shims to raise or reduce the door frame.Locks and Latches
Locks can end up being stiff or jammed due to wear, dirt accumulation, or misalignment.
Repair Steps:
Lubricate the Lock: Apply a graphite-based lube to keep the lock operating efficiently.Realign the Lock: If the lock is misaligned, adjust the position of the strike plate.Change if Necessary: If the lock is beyond repair, change it with a new one that matches the existing setup.Weather condition Stripping

Scratches and staining can interfere with the appearance of your UPVC door.
Repair Steps:
Clean the Surface: Use a mild detergent to clean the location.Polish: For small scratches, make use of a UPVC polish to restore shine.Repaint: For deeper scratches, consider repainting with an ideal UPVC paint.Hinges
Hinges can rust or loosen, triggering functional troubles.
Repair Steps:
Lubricate Hinges: Use a silicone spray to keep them working smoothly.Tighten up Screws: Ensure that hinge screws are sufficiently tightened up.Change: If the hinges are seriously rusted or damaged, replace them.Preventative Maintenance Tips
